Summary
  1. Promotional video on the Broadway production of A tale of two cities, a musical adaptation of Dickens' novel. Consists of rehearsal footage, excerpts from interviews with the composer, director, cast and creative team, brief excerpts from the show during preview performances, etc. The video is broken into twenty-two separate segments, each covering a different aspect of the production, and each running from two to three minutes.

Biography (note)
  1. The Broadway production of Jill Santoriello's musical adaptation of A tale of two cities opened at the Al Hirschfeld Theatre on September 18, 2008, and closed on Nov. 9, 2008.
